技术文摘
HTML5 中如何显示文本的 Ruby 注释
HTML5 中如何显示文本的 Ruby 注释
在 HTML5 页面设计中,显示文本的 Ruby 注释是一项能为内容增添丰富信息的实用技巧。Ruby 注释,也叫旁注,常用于在东亚语言文本中为汉字添加拼音或注音。下面我们就来探讨如何在 HTML5 中实现这一功能。
在 HTML5 里,<ruby> 标签是实现文本 Ruby 注释的关键。这个标签专门用于定义 Ruby 注释,也就是在一个字符的上方或者旁边显示一个较小的文本。比如我们有一段包含汉字的文本,想要为其添加拼音注释,就可以使用 <ruby> 标签来轻松达成。
具体的语法结构如下:<ruby>被注释的文本<rt>注释文本</rt></ruby>。这里,<rt> 标签用于指定 <ruby> 元素的 Ruby 注释内容。例如,我们想要为“苹果”这个词添加拼音注释“píng guǒ”,代码可以这样写:<ruby>苹果<rt>píng guǒ</rt></ruby>。当这段代码在支持 HTML5 的浏览器中渲染时,就会显示出“苹果”,并且在其上方或者旁边显示拼音“píng guǒ”,方便读者了解读音。
除了 <rt> 标签,还有 <rp> 标签也常与 <ruby> 标签配合使用。<rp> 标签用于在不支持 Ruby 注释的浏览器中提供备用的显示方式。例如,在某些较旧的浏览器中,如果不支持 <ruby> 和 <rt> 标签的功能,通过 <rp> 标签可以将注释以一种合理的形式呈现出来。代码示例如下:<ruby>苹果<rp>(</rp><rt>píng guǒ</rt><rp>)</rp></ruby>。这样,在不支持的浏览器中,可能会显示为“苹果(píng guǒ)”。
掌握在 HTML5 中显示文本的 Ruby 注释,不仅能提升页面内容对于东亚语言使用者的友好度,也能让页面信息传递更加准确和丰富。无论是制作教育类网站、语言学习资料展示页面,还是其他涉及东亚语言文本解释的场景,这一技巧都能发挥重要作用。通过合理运用 <ruby>、<rt> 和 <rp> 标签,开发者可以确保不同浏览器环境下,用户都能获取到准确且清晰的文本注释信息,为用户带来更好的浏览体验。
- IBM产品助力SaaS解决方案专栏
- Watir助力Web应用自动化测试加速
- Java 2运行时安全模型下的线程协作
- 企业级加密文件系统eCryptfs详细解析
- 软件及系统交付的协作与集成解决方案
- IBM数据库技术疑难常见问题精选
- 借助DCT实现Lotus Domino配置优化
- WebSphere Application Server启动bean的部署
- Lotus Forms产品优化及问题诊断
- 智慧地球,Rational更智慧
- IBM Lotus Quickr助力快速打造强大团队
- Lotus Notes/Domino和Portal的集成实践
- IBM与SAP携手开发定制工作流决策
- 剖析IBM Lotus Domino服务器集群
- Lotus Symphony文本识别应用